摘要
本文根据5G部署对汇聚机房的需求
对汇聚机房配套能力算法进行探讨。主要包括机房面积需求算法
探讨如何将机房面积与设备数量直接挂钩;蓄电池容量需求算法
探讨如何根据装机需求和备电时长计算蓄电池容量;空调制冷量及功耗需求算法
探讨机房空调如何配置;机房交流引入容量算法
探讨机房交流引入容量如何简单准确计算。最后给出各类汇聚机房的配套建设标准。
Abstract
In this paper
according to the requirements of 5G deployment for the convergence room
the algorithm of the supporting facilities capacity of the convergence room is discussed
It mainly includes the room area demand algorithm
discusses how to directly link the room area with the number of equipment; Battery capacity demand algorithm
discusses how to calculate battery capacity according to the installed demand and backup power duration; Air conditioning cooling capacity and power consumption demand algorithm
discusses how to configure the room air conditioning; Room AC introduced capacity algorithm
discusses how the room AC introduced capacity is simple and accurate exact calculation and the supporting facilities construction standards of all kinds of convergence room are given.
